Behavioral Counseling
Behavior problems can be due to medical or behavioral causes, or both. A clinical history, physical examination, and diagnostic testing will help determine if there are underlying medical conditions contributing to the problem.
Although there may be a single cause for a behavior problem, it is often the combined effect of the environment and learning on the pet’s mental and physical health that determines behavior.
After evaluation, our veterinarians can help coach you on a behavior modification plan, as well as recommend daily or as needed behavior medications.
If needed, we may refer you to a board-certified veterinary behavior specialist.
